On May 8, Mgen Solution announced that it had received a notification of patent registration from the Korean Intellectual Property Office for its AI-based fire detection and suppression system.
This patent covers a system that analyzes footage collected from closed-circuit (CC) TV using AI to detect the 'first spark' and, at the same time, precisely target the location of the fire to activate an automatic suppression device.
According to the company, while fire detection and warning systems using AI video analysis have existed previously, this is the first time a system has been developed that can accurately identify the fire location and link it with an automatic suppression device for fire response.
Amid growing risks of large-scale wildfires due to recent climate change, there have been calls to comprehensively overhaul the wildfire response system. According to a report by the National Assembly Research Service, wildfires have become larger and the extent of the damage has increased since the 2020s. In fact, compared to the 2010s, the area affected by wildfires in the 2020s increased by 7.8 times, and the number of large wildfires exceeding 1 million square meters rose by 3.7 times.
Lee Taekki, head of the research center at Mgen Solution, stated, "While automatic suppression systems using traditional flame detection sensors can be operated indoors, they are prone to malfunctions in outdoor environments, making their application difficult."
He added, "The technology we have developed and patented this time can accurately detect fire locations outdoors and share this information with automatic suppression devices," emphasizing, "It is particularly effective for initial fire response in outdoor situations such as wildfires."
Mgen Solution is focusing on developing various next-generation firefighting devices, including firefighting robots and multi-drone-based wildfire disaster response systems. The company is working to establish an integrated firefighting solution that covers the entire process from fire detection to initial response, real-time monitoring, and spread prevention, and is continuously expanding its product portfolio.
